      8  This program tests the assertion that a signal explicitly declared to execute on
      9  an alternate stack (using sigaltstack) shall be delivered on the alternate stack
     10  specified by ss.
     11 
     12  While it is easy to use a call like sigaltstack((stack_t *)0, &oss) to verify
     13  that the signal stack that the handler is being executed on is the same alternate
     14  signal stack ss that I defined for that signal, I do not want to rely of the
     15  use of oss since we're testing sigaltstack().
     16 
     17  Instead, what I do is declare an integer i inside the handler and verify that
     18  at least the address of i is located between ss.ss_sp and ss.ss_size.
     19 
     20 */
     21 
     22 #define _XOPEN_SOURCE 600
     23 
     24 #include <signal.h>
     25 #include <stdio.h>
     26 #include <stdlib.h>
     27 #include "posixtest.h"
     28 
     29 #define SIGTOTEST SIGUSR1
     30 
     31 stack_t alternate_s;
     32 
     33 void handler()
     34 {
     35 	int i = 0;
     36 	if ((void *)&i < (alternate_s.ss_sp)
     37 	    || (long)&i >=
     38 	    ((long)alternate_s.ss_sp + (long)alternate_s.ss_size)) {
     39 
     40 		printf
     41 		    ("Test FAILED: address of local variable is not inside the memory allocated for the alternate signal stack\n");
     42 		exit(PTS_FAIL);
     43 	}
     44 }
     45 
     46 int main(void)
     47 {
     48 
     49 	struct sigaction act;
     50 	act.sa_flags = SA_ONSTACK;
     51 	act.sa_handler = handler;
     52 	sigemptyset(&act.sa_mask);
     53 
     54 	if (sigaction(SIGUSR1, &act, 0) == -1) {
     55 		perror
     56 		    ("Unexpected error while attempting to setup test pre-conditions");
     57 		return PTS_UNRESOLVED;
     58 	}
     59 
     60 	if ((alternate_s.ss_sp = malloc(SIGSTKSZ)) == NULL) {
     61 		perror
     62 		    ("Unexpected error while attempting to setup test pre-conditions");
     63 		return PTS_UNRESOLVED;
     64 	}
     65 
     66 	alternate_s.ss_flags = 0;
     67 	alternate_s.ss_size = SIGSTKSZ;
     68 
     69 	if (sigaltstack(&alternate_s, NULL) == -1) {
     70 		perror
     71 		    ("Unexpected error while attempting to setup test pre-conditions");
     72 		return PTS_UNRESOLVED;
     73 	}
     74 
     75 	if (raise(SIGUSR1) == -1) {
     76 		perror
     77 		    ("Unexpected error while attempting to setup test pre-conditions");
     78 		return PTS_UNRESOLVED;
     79 	}
     80 
     81 	printf("Test PASSED\n");
     82 	return PTS_PASS;
     83 }
